10 Essential Tips and Tricks for Boosting Sales as an Optical Sales Executive
Thriving as an optical sales executive requires more than just understanding the products. It's about creating a connection with customers, identifying their needs, and delivering solutions that keep them coming back. In a competitive market, optimizing your sales strategies is crucial. Here are 10 essential tips and tricks to boost your sales effectively.
1. Deepen Your Product Knowledge
The foundation of a successful sale lies in deep, comprehensive product knowledge. As an optical sales executive, you should be well-versed in the specifications, benefits, and unique features of the eyewear brands your store offers. This enables you to provide accurate information and answer customer queries confidently. Stay updated with the latest trends and technologies in optics to add value to the customer experience.
2. Personalize the Customer Experience
Each customer is unique, and a one-size-fits-all approach does not work in sales. Take time to understand your customer's lifestyle, preferences, and needs. Use this understanding to tailor your recommendations and provide them with products that genuinely meet their requirements. Personalized service not only boosts immediate sales but also builds long-term loyalty.
3. Leverage the Power of Cross-Selling and Upselling
Maximize revenue by implementing strategic cross-selling and upselling techniques. Once you've identified a customer's primary interest, suggest complementary products, such as lens cleaners or protective cases. Similarly, if a customer shows interest in budget eyewear, guide them towards higher-end alternatives by highlighting superior features and long-term benefits.
4. Enhance Your Communication Skills
Effective communication is the cornerstone of successful sales. It's about more than just speaking; it's about listening to and understanding customer needs. Use clear and concise language, avoid jargon, and maintain a friendly, approachable demeanor. Good communication builds trust, which is essential for closing deals.
5. Master Your Sales Pitch
A well-crafted sales pitch can make all the difference in converting a prospect into a customer. Your pitch should be compelling, concise, and focused on customer benefits rather than product features. Practice your pitch regularly to ensure you can deliver it smoothly and confidently in any situation.
6. Build Strong Relationships
In the sales world, relationships are everything. Engage with your customers beyond the sale by keeping in touch, following up on their purchases, and informing them about new arrivals or special offers. Building strong customer relationships will increase the likelihood of repeat business and referrals.
7. Maintain a Professional Appearance
Your appearance can significantly impact customer perceptions and sales success. Ensure that you are well-groomed and dressed appropriately for the store's environment. A professional appearance instills confidence and trust in your abilities as a sales executive.
8. Set and Monitor Goals
Establishing clear sales goals provides direction and motivation. Set achievable targets for yourself, whether they be daily, weekly, or monthly, and monitor your progress regularly. Adjust your strategies based on performance metrics to continually improve your technique and achieve your goals.
9. Utilize Technology
The optics industry is rapidly evolving with technology. Make use of available tools such as virtual try-on solutions and customer relationship management (CRM) software to enhance the shopping experience. These technologies can streamline processes, improve accuracy in product selection, and provide personalized recommendations to customers.
10. Educate Your Customers
Providing education on eyewear products can set you apart from competitors. Explain the benefits of different lens materials, the importance of proper fit, or the advantages of anti-reflective coatings. An informed customer is more likely to make confident purchases, leading to increased satisfaction and loyalty.
In conclusion, boosting sales as an optical sales executive involves a blend of product knowledge, effective communication, technology utilization, and strong customer relationships. By implementing these tips and tricks, you can enhance your sales strategy and position yourself as a trusted advisor in the eyes of your customers, leading to increased sales and satisfaction.
